X-Git-Url: http://pileus.org/git/?a=blobdiff_plain;f=src%2FMakefile.am;h=6ac5415bb013c639c7e0d4bcc2afc19c6b49241e;hb=7c1875120499d15fd82d9ed49f934734852bb9c3;hp=fb2e6f5e4cc42e34a9a4a5f9e21fd8635fbadd8c;hpb=0b22be9563d7fd7b63294b5cffb1954726b933ff;p=aweather diff --git a/src/Makefile.am b/src/Makefile.am index fb2e6f5..6ac5415 100644 --- a/src/Makefile.am +++ b/src/Makefile.am @@ -1,26 +1,27 @@ SUBDIRS = plugins AM_CFLAGS = -Wall --std=gnu99 $(GRITS_CFLAGS) -AM_LDFLAGS = -Wl,--export-dynamic \ - -Wl,--as-needed -Wl,--no-undefined +AM_LDFLAGS = -Wl,--export-dynamic -Wl,--no-undefined + +if !SYS_MAC +AM_LDFLAGS += -Wl,--as-needed +endif bin_PROGRAMS = aweather wsr88ddec aweather_SOURCES = main.c \ aweather-gui.c aweather-gui.h \ aweather-location.c aweather-location.h aweather_CPPFLAGS = \ - -DHTMLDIR="\"$(dots)$(htmldir)\"" \ - -DICONDIR="\"$(dots)$(datadir)/icons\"" \ - -DPKGDATADIR="\"$(dots)$(pkgdatadir)\"" \ - -DPLUGINSDIR="\"$(dots)$(pkglibdir)\"" + -DHTMLDIR="\"$(DOTS)$(htmldir)\"" \ + -DICONDIR="\"$(DOTS)$(datadir)/icons\"" \ + -DPKGDATADIR="\"$(DOTS)$(pkgdatadir)\"" \ + -DPLUGINSDIR="\"$(DOTS)$(pkglibdir)\"" aweather_LDADD = $(GRITS_LIBS) wsr88ddec = wsr88ddec.c wsr88ddec_LDADD = $(GLIB_LIBS) -lbz2 -if WIN32 -dots = .. - +if SYS_WIN wsr88ddec_LDFLAGS = -mwindows aweather_SOURCES += resource.rc @@ -33,6 +34,11 @@ aweather_dbg_CPPFLAGS = $(aweather_CPPFLAGS) aweather_dbg_LDADD = $(aweather_LDADD) endif +if SYS_MAC +aweather_CPPFLAGS += $(MAC_CFLAGS) +aweather_LDADD += $(MAC_LIBS) +endif + .rc.o: ../data/icons/48x48/aweather.ico $(RC) -o $@ $< @@ -40,7 +46,8 @@ CLEANFILES = gmon.out valgrind.out MAINTAINERCLEANFILES = Makefile.in test: all - .libs/aweather -o -d 7 -s KOUN -t '2011-02-01 10:01Z' + .libs/aweather -o -d 5 +#.libs/aweather -o -d 7 -s KOUN -t '2011-02-01 10:01Z' #.libs/aweather -o -d 7 -s KLSX -t '2010-12-31 17:56Z' #.libs/aweather -o -d 7 -s KDGX -t '2010-12-31 23:10Z' #.libs/aweather -o -d 7 -s KDGX -t '1999-05-03 23:51Z'